查看标签关联的dockerFile

View dockerFile associated with tag

dockerFile 是否与容器的 a 标签相关联,可以在 dockerhub 上查看?

正在查看 tensorflow 等示例容器https://hub.docker.com/r/tensorflow/tensorflow/tags/此信息不可用?

https://github.com/tensorflow/tensorflow/blob/master/tensorflow/tools/docker/Dockerfile

我查看了 repo 信息,然后在描述中查看了更多详细信息 link,并探索了 github 项目。您可能想检查那里的 git 标签以获得更符合实际标签的 dockerfiles。

显然不是每个人都在 dockerhub 上发布它们。

如果 Dockerfile 不可用,您可以随时

  • 使用 docker history 并查看使用了哪些命令,请参阅帮助

https://docs.docker.com/engine/reference/commandline/history/

  • 使用Dockerfile-from-image从镜像构建Dockerfile,参见

https://github.com/CenturyLinkLabs/dockerfile-from-image

你不会确切地知道做了什么,因为当你看到 ADDCOPY 时你无法确切地知道复制了哪个文件,内容是什么,但你会得到一个很好的想法